Gastronomically Mobile

Two weeks ago, one of the student organizations from our college invited two  food kiosks. One was a Shawarma van and the other was a Kombi type kiosk.
Let's start with the former. I tasted the shawarma rice and it was good and satisfying but it's too pricey for our elementary and high school students. The lowest price for their shawarma is 85 pesos hence with that amount our students can have two servings of rice, two viands and a drink. The shawarma van kiosk lasted only for two days. 
Now with the Kombi sausage kiosk. Personally I enjoyed their sausage sandwiches. I tasted two variants. Although it's served as a burger type the goodness,tenderness and the juiciness of the sausage is still there.
It's also pricey but at least they serve free iced tea.
